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 10011
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 10011?
Actualmente hay 1,769 Apartamentos Estudios en 10011 con alquileres que van desde $1,817 hasta $8,000, con un precio medio de $4,413.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 10011?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 10011 varian entre $1,900 y $34,834 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,947
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 10011?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 10011 van desde $2,395 hasta $22,108.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$7,983
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 10011?
En estos momentos hay 223 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 10011 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$4,522 y $31,480 - con una media de $9,352 para el lugar.
